June 6th Razor: RR Rocnel Sailor 2021 Blade: Feather NHS (1) Brush: Grizzly Bay Biblical/TnS gelled boar Pre-shave: PAA Cube Soap: A&E Asian Plum PAA Galactic Witch Hazel PAA Star Jelly AS: A&E Asian Plum Good morning! 2021 Rocnel Sailor. Work of art. Two piece razor. The topcap is removed by unscrewing the adjustment knob. The handle is just shy of three inches according to the specs. Three fingers and a pinkie supporting the razor from the bottom and the handle all but dissappears. It felt perfectly natural to me. The adjustment knob is marked • I II III IV V. It can be fine tuned anywhere between each setting and go a couple of turns beyond the max setting should the need arise. I decided to try it out at the •, the lowest setting. I found the angle to be intuitive and even at the lowest setting there was some wiggle room. The angle didn't have to be spot on. Super smooth shave. I did my usual three passes. I do feel a bit of sandpaper under my chin which I attribute to user error. Just the lightest tickle from the alum on my neck. Excellent first shave. Tomorrow I'll dial it up to I and continue up the ladder as I get to know the razor. Have a great day! Sent from my SM-G965U using Tapatalk
